Transaction 7538a3d39af3e9eece9845d52ecc5109fe32b8a56a1ff4a3c09f5a76c74d6414

2 Input
2 Outputs
  • 7538a3d39af3e9eece9845d52ecc5109fe32b8a56a1ff4a3c09f5a76c74d6414:0
  • value  1316777
    address  189PSDLTt6mpxyTcYDmSv5XLxriF8vk33o
  • 7538a3d39af3e9eece9845d52ecc5109fe32b8a56a1ff4a3c09f5a76c74d6414:1
  • value  527420
    address  1MZFhwGaicKWZhiYQp5RGqskFRJsSSfWvB